JM's latest stock split occurred on Jun 26, 2006
The company executed a 4-for-1 stock split, meaning that for every share held, investors received 4 new shares.
The adjusted shares began trading on Jun 26, 2006. This was the only stock split in JM's history.

JM AB engages in the business of real estate and property development activities. The company is headquartered in Solna, Stockholm and currently employs 2,453 full-time employees. The firm is engaged in the acquisition of development properties, planning, pre-construction, production and sales of residential units, with its main focus being the expansion of metropolitan areas and university towns in Sweden, Denmark, Finland and Belgium. The company is also involved in project development of commercial premises and contract work, mainly in the Greater Stockholm area in Sweden. Its operations are structured into five business segments: JM Residential Stockholm, JM Residential Sweden, JM International, JM Property Development and JM Production. In Sweden the Company operates primarily under the JM brand, as well as under the Seniorgarden and Boratt names.
